A framework for parameter optimization in mutual information (MI)-based registration algorithms
SPIE Proceedings, 2006In this paper, we present a framework that one could use to set optimized parameter values, while performing image registration using mutual information as a metric to be maximized. Our experiment details these steps for the registration of X-ray Computer Tomography (CT) images with Positron Emission Tomography (PET) images.

Multi-modal Image Registration by Quantitative-Qualitative Measure of Mutual Information (Q-MI)
2005This paper presents a novel measure of image similarity, called quantitative-qualitative measure of mutual information (Q-MI), for multi-modal image registration. Conventional information measure, i.e., Shannon’s entropy, is a quantitative measure of information, since it only considers probabilities, not utilities of events.
